We like it when good products are further improved, like the new FALKE S D-Pol Red Dot. We reviewed the solid predecessor in 2020 HERE. Now the improved version is on the market. We'll tell you what has been improved.
Essentially, it's the same red dot sight that is used by the Thuringia Police, only without the coat of arms lasered onto the device. Otherwise, everything inside and out is the same.
The most noticeable change is the mounting. Moving away from quick mounting to a screw-on mounting system. The mounting is designed so that the iron sights (depending on the weapon type) can still be used.
A subtle improvement has been made in the area of the flip-up covers. During evaluation by the Thuringia Police, it was found that the covers were not easy to flip up with gloves and that the optics were sometimes pressed by the covers. So the "ears" on the covers have been slightly enlarged and the housing has been provided with a groove. Problem identified, problem solved.
There are also improvements inside. One of them is a revision of the power consumption unit. The police noticed that after a few thousand shots on the same brightness setting (without any changes), there could be a darkening of the reticle due to minimal wear and tear. This is no longer possible with the newly designed internals. FALKE tested this with over 50,000 (simulated) shots.
The resistance of the adjustment turret for brightness control has also been adjusted, as it was rated slightly too high by the police. Now it moves a bit easier, but without being too loose.
All in all, the FALKE S has been made even more robust and durable than its predecessor. It's good news for the customers, as the RRP of the FALKE S D-Pol Red Dot Sight is expected to decrease slightly, offering better quality at a lower price.
